Collingham to Haslemere by train

A train trip from Collingham to Haslemere takes about 5hrs 11 mins on average, covering roughly 142 miles (228 kilometres). With around 17 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£33.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Collingham to Haslemere journ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Collingham to Haslemere start from as little as £33.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Collingham to Haslemere start from £58.40 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Collingham to Haslemere are available for £129.90 one way

Everything you need to know about Collingham Station

Welcome to Collingham Train Station

Nestled in Nottinghamshire, England, Collingham Train Station serves the charming village of Collingham. Although small and modest, this station plays a crucial role in connecting residents and visitors to the wider UK rail network. Whether you're a daily commuter or a curious traveler, this quaint station has more to offer than meets the eye.

Facilities and Accessibility

Unfortunately, Collingham station doesn't boast a ticket office or vending machines yet. So, if you're planning a trip, it's wise to purchase tickets online beforehand. Though this means there's no option to collect tickets on-site, you can always rely on online booking platforms for seamless ticket purchasing.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ments and a help point for information.

For travelers in need of accessibility, the station's step-free access is somewhat limited but present with a ramp featuring a moderate gradient on Platform 1 and Platform 2. Keep in mind the transfer between platforms involves crossing the tracks at a level crossing, which may be uneven in surface.

Parking and Transport Links

The East Midlands Railway operates a car park with an economical pricing structure. With 61 spaces and 3 designated for accessible parking, it's practical for those traveling with a vehicle. As for other transportation options to and from the station, while there are no on-site taxis or cycle hire facilities, a rail replacement service is conveniently located adjacent to the station car park. For bus links and other travel plans, printable information is easily accessible here.

Amenities

It's worth noting that the station is limited in terms of amenities, without ATMs, shops, refreshment facilities, or waiting rooms. However, with CCTV presence, some cycle storage, and the scenic village itself, Collington continues to offer a serene and secure travel atmosphere.

Everything you need to know about Haslemere Station

Exploring Haslemere Train Station: A Gateway to the UK's Railway Network

Situated amidst the scenic beauty of Surrey, Haslemere Train Station serves as a bustling hub for passengers travelling across the UK. Whether you're commuting for work, planning a leisurely trip, or simply exploring southern England, Haslemere's strategic location and amenities make it a key point of departure on your rail journey.

Station Details and Facilities

With its range of services, Haslemere Train Station ensures a smooth experience for all travelers. The station boasts a well-staffed ticket office open from the early morning through the evening, alongside ticket machines that are equipped to handle smartcard validations. This makes last-minute ticket purchases or collections a breeze. Importantly, all machines cater to the needs of disabled passengers, offering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

Accessibility is top-notch, with step-free access available across the station, making it easy for passengers with limited mobility to navigate. An accessible waiting room and toilets further enhance the convenience. For cyclists, the station provides storage for up to 192 bicycles in a secured, CCTV-monitored cycle hub.

Onward Travel Options

Beyond the station, Haslemere is well-connected to other modes of transport. If your journey continues by road, the station offers connections to local bus services, with detailed travel plans available here. Rail replacement services are conveniently located on Lower Street (B2131), ensuring seamless transit during service disruptions.
